Subject: [PATCH 32/32] fuse: simplify fuse_dev_ioctl_clone()
Date: Thu, 16 Apr 2026 11:16:56 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20260416091658.462783-33-mszeredi@redhat.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20260416091658.462783-1-mszeredi@redhat.com>

Don't need to check if the new device file is already initialized, since
fuse_dev_install_with_pq() will do that anyway.

Make fuse_dev_install_with_pq() return a boolean value indicating success so
that fuse_dev_ioctl_clone() can return an error in case of failure.
